Supplies

IMG_0112.jpeg
  1. Cutting pliers
  2. round nose pliers
  3. Long nose pliers
  4. beads
  5. pearls
  6. Thin gold wire
  7. gold eye pins
  8. Gold clasps
  9. jump rings

Creating the Bracelet

  1. I placed one small pink bead onto the eye pin and used my cutting pliers to cut it to an appropriate length.
  2. i used the round nose pliers to curl the end of the eye pin to create another eye and I used my long nose pliers to press down on it so it creates a closed loop
  3. i repeated the previous step but instead of closing the loop i feed it through the other loop i created on the first bead and then i close the loop.
  4. i repeated the third step while interchanging between the pink beads and the pearls until the chain was long enough to go around my wrist.
  5. i attached a jump ring to one end of the chain and attached a jump ring and a clasp to the other end of the chain and I had my bracelet.

Making the Ring

  1. the first thing I did was to wrap the golden wire around a cylinder shaped thing to get the shape of the ring and I made sure that what I used as a template wasn’t too big or too small for my finger
  2. i then fed three beads through the golden wire and pushed them to the middle of the wire
  3. i then took both ends of my wire and wrapped them around the ring tightly to hold the beads and the whole ring in place
  4. i used my long nose pliers to secure the ends of the golden wire and make sure it doesn’t poke out or unravel

Make the Connecting Chain

  1. I did the same process I used to make the bracelet to make the connecting chain and I made it to my desired length
  2. I attached jump rings to both ends of the chain then attached one of the jump ring to the middle of the bracelet through the chain loops
  3. then I attached the other jump ring through the ring that I had made earlier
  4. i made sure everything was connected properly and well held together
